What is a Powered Mobility Scooter?

Powered mobility scooters are battery-operated gadgets that resemble a little bike or a three-wheeled automobile. They usually have a seat, handlebars, and controls, permitting users to navigate different surfaces easily. These scooters cater to individuals with restricted mobility due to age, disability, or health conditions, offering a practical solution for navigating.

Table 1: Key Components of a Powered Mobility Scooter

ComponentDescriptionSeatComfortable and adjustable seating for the user.Guiding HandleEnables the user to manage instructions and speed.ThrottleA lever or button that manages velocity.Brake SystemElectronic or mechanical brakes for safety.Battery PackRechargeable batteries that power the scooter.WheelsDiffers in size and type for different terrains.BasketStorage area for personal items or shopping bags.

Types of Powered Mobility Scooters

When https://best-mobility-scootersdbnl456.trexgame.net/10-inspirational-images-of-mobility-scooters-uk thinking about a powered mobility scooter, it is essential to comprehend the different types offered in the market. Each type is developed to accommodate particular requirements and preferences.

1. Three-Wheel Scooters

    Pros: More maneuverable, suitable for indoor use. Cons: Less steady than four-wheel scooters.

2. Four-Wheel Scooters

    Pros: Improved stability, suitable for outdoor terrain. Cons: Bulkier, less maneuverable in tight spaces.

3. Portable/Travel Scooters

    Pros: Lightweight, simple to take apart for transportation. Cons: Limited weight capability and variety.

4. Durable Scooters

    Pros: Higher weight capacity, ideal for larger users. Cons: Heavier, less portable.

Table 2: Comparison of Scooter Types

Scooter TypeManeuverabilityStabilityWeight CapacityPortabilityThree-WheelHighModerateLowModerateFour-WheelModerateHighModerateLowPortable/TravelHighLowLowHighSturdyModerateHighHighLow

Factors to consider Before Purchasing a Mobility Scooter

Before investing in a powered mobility scooter, it's essential to consider different elements to ensure the very best suitable for private requirements.

1. Weight Capacity

    Guarantee the scooter can support the user's weight easily.

2. Terrain Compatibility

    Consider where the scooter will be utilized most frequently. Select a model ideal for indoor, outside, or mixed terrain.

3. Battery Life

    Search for a scooter with sufficient battery variety for prepared usage. Some users require longer battery life, especially for outside expeditions.

4. Storage and Transport

    If taking a trip regularly, a portable design might be best. Think about the storage area offered for the scooter when not in use.

5. Budget

    Mobility scooters can differ significantly in rate. Assess the budget while thinking about functions and service warranties.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How fast do powered mobility scooters go?

    Most powered mobility scooters have a top speed of 4 to 8 miles per hour.

2. Do I need a license to run a mobility scooter?

    Usually, you do not require a motorist's license for a powered mobility scooter, however it's necessary to examine local regulations.

3. Can mobility scooters be utilized on pathways?

    In lots of locations, mobility scooters can be utilized on pathways, however it's crucial to follow local laws concerning their usage.

4. What is the typical lifespan of a mobility scooter?

    With appropriate upkeep, a powered mobility scooter can last between 3 to 5 years.

5. Are mobility scooters covered by insurance?

    Some insurance plans may cover part of the cost of a mobility scooter. It's suggested to consult your insurer for specific coverage information.
